Diseases of the blood and blood-forming organs and certain disorders involving the immune mechanism (D50–D89) ICD-10-CM
Chapter 3 of the ICD-10-CM classification spans codes D50–D89 and contains 401 diagnosis codes for diseases of the blood and blood-forming organs and certain disorders involving the immune mechanism, of which 323 are billable. Chapter Coding Notes
Excludes2: autoimmune disease (systemic) NOS (M35.9), certain conditions originating in the perinatal period (P00-P96), complications of pregnancy, childbirth and the puerperium (O00-O9A), congenital malformations, deformations and chromosomal abnormalities (Q00-Q99), endocrine, nutritional and metabolic diseases (E00-E88), human immunodeficiency virus [HIV] disease (B20) injury, poisoning and certain other consequences of external causes (S00-T88), neoplasms (C00-D49) symptoms, signs and abnormal clinical and laboratory findings, not elsewhere classified (R00-R94)

About Chapter 3
ICD-10-CM Chapter 3 covers conditions related to the blood, blood-forming organs, and immune system disorders. It includes codes for anemia, coagulation defects, and immunodeficiencies.
This chapter encompasses a wide range of disorders affecting how blood cells develop and function, including various types of anemia such as iron-deficiency or hemolytic anemia. It also addresses coagulation defects that impact blood clotting processes, leading to bleeding or clotting issues. Additionally, codes in this range represent immune system disorders where the body's defense mechanisms are weakened or abnormal, such as immunodeficiencies or autoimmune conditions. Healthcare providers use these codes to document diagnoses related to blood abnormalities and immune dysfunctions accurately. This ensures clear communication for treatment planning, insurance claims, and epidemiological tracking of these diseases.
